Harmful Effects of Walckenaer's studded arkys
A species of Triangular spiders, Also known as Triangular crab spider
Walckenaer's studded arkys poses minimal health risks to humans, with bites occurring rarely and typically only when provoked. Transmission of health risks is primarily through bites, which are a defense mechanism and result in mild symptoms. These are not life-threatening and seldom require medical treatment.
